Large Airports ...
- Newark Liberty Intl. (EWR/KEWR)
(27 miles [43.5 km] to the north)
- John F. Kennedy Intl. (JFK/KJFK)
(30 miles [48.3 km] to the northeast)
- La Guardia Airport (LGA/KLGA)
(36 miles [57.9 km] to the north northeast)
- Atlantic City Intl. (ACY/KACY)
(62 miles [99.8 km] to the south southwest)
- Philadelphia Intl. (PHL/KPHL)
(64 miles [103 km] to the west southwest)
- Long Island MacArthur Airport (ISP/KISP)
(64 miles [103 km] to the east northeast)
